• IMPORTANT: Welcome to the re-opening of GameRebels! We are excited to be back and hope everyone has had a great time away. Everyone is welcome!

Auto Racing

Guardian

Well-Known Member
Joined
May 5, 2012
Messages
982
Reaction score
58
Anyone here a fan of auto racing?

I sort of am. I can't sit and watch a whole race, although I did in person once. I'm more interested in doing the racing myself than watching others.
 

Toxique

Well-Known Member
MOTM
Joined
Jan 27, 2012
Messages
3,910
Reaction score
11
I'm not really a fan of it, I'll watch some of it once in a while though.
 
Top